Major Duties:
1. Manages the daily P&L and valuation process covering various cash securities and derivative products.
2. Prepares daily P&L and risk reports, as well as P&L attribution and explanation to clients.
3. Prepares and manages monthly (or more frequently as required) price verification process and associated reporting.
4. Manages any necessary model review process and associated documentation.
5. Coordinates monthly close process with corporate/fund accounting.
6. Engages with clients and valuation vendors to complete review of new products.
7. Prepares presentations and analysis as required on trading strategies, process improvement, and valuation analysis.
8. Designs and implements process improvements to improve daily P&L and price verification process.
